I've always heard that you shouldn't update a jailbroken iPod/iPhone but no one has ever specified what happens. iOS 5 is coming out and I hate having to restore my iPod every single time there's an update because putting my music and apps back on takes almost all day. So is it safe or should I just restore it?

afaik updating your ipod touch, you will lose all your jailbreak stuff but will keep everything else that is legit (music, movies, pics, ebooks, apps, ect...)

It's safe to update any device to ios 5 if its a supported device. the only problematic units are the Iphone 3G's with the ipad baseband 06.15.00 on them but they can be updated successfully too as I have one in this state on ios 5. took some effort....
